12. Notices
12(a) Effectiveness. Any notice or other communication in respect of this Agreement may be given in any manner
described below (except that a notice or other communication under Section 5 or 6 may not be given by electronic
messaging system or e-mail) to the address or number or in accordance with the electronic messaging system or
e-mail details provided (see the Schedule) and will be deemed effective as indicated:―

(i) if in writing and delivered in person or by courier, on the date it is delivered;
(ii) if sent by telex, on the date the recipient’s answerback is received;
(iii) if sent by facsimile transmission, on the date it is received by a responsible employee of the
recipient in legible form (it being agreed that the burden of proving receipt will be on the sender and will not
be met by a transmission report generated by the sender’s facsimile machine);
(iv) if sent by certified or registered mail (airmail, if overseas) or the equivalent (return receipt
requested), on the date it is delivered or its delivery is attempted;
(v) if sent by electronic messaging system, on the date it is received; or
(vi) if sent by e-mail, on the date it is delivered,

unless the date of that delivery (or attempted delivery) or that receipt, as applicable, is not a Local Business Day or
that communication is delivered (or attempted) or received, as applicable, after the close of business on a Local
Business Day, in which case that communication will be deemed given and effective on the first following day that is
a Local Business Day.
